Subtle changes in perivascular endometrial mesenchymal stem cells after local endometrial injury in recurrent implantation failure

HIGHLIGHTS

  • who: Yiping Fan from the DepartmentUniversity Health have published the paper: Subtle changes in perivascular endometrial mesenchymal stem cells after local endometrial injury in recurrent implantation failure, in the Journal: Scientific Reports Scientific Reports
  • what: The authors have shown that u00adSUSD2+ cells isolated from two sequential LEI biopsies of women with RIF were clonogenic, highly proliferative and could decidualize.
